Common Questions About Local Safety Data

What specific types of incidents are typically included in these reports?

Data on police activity generally encompasses a wide range of non-sensitive categories, including property crimes, vandalism, traffic-related calls, and public disturbances. These reports focus on verifiable events that require an official response, providing a broad overview of community interactions with law enforcement. By examining trends in these areas, residents can identify patterns without delving into private matters or individual circumstances. The goal is to present a factual landscape of public order issues.

How can I access this information for my own community?

Accessing local safety data is often more straightforward than one might assume. Most municipal governments maintain public records portals where incident logs and crime statistics are published. You can start by visiting your city or countyโ€™s official website and looking for a โ€œTransparencyโ€ or โ€œPublic Safetyโ€ section. Many departments also offer email subscriptions to alert residents to monthly or quarterly updates. For a more curated analysis, reputable local journalism organizations or community advocacy groups sometimes compile this raw data into interactive maps or summary reports, making it easier to grasp at a glance.

Does an increase in reported activity mean the area is becoming more dangerous?

Not necessarily. An uptick in reported incidents can often be attributed to improved reporting mechanisms, increased community vigilance, or a temporary concentration of patrol resources in a specific area. It is crucial to look at trends over extended periods rather than reacting to single data points. A graph showing a sudden spike in one month might normalize when viewed over a six-month or yearly span. Context is key; data reflects activity levels, but it does not always equate to a deteriorating quality of life without deeper demographic and socioeconomic analysis.

Addressing Common Misunderstandings

A significant misunderstanding surrounding the analysis of local police activity is the conflation of volume with severity. Just because an incident is reported frequently does not mean it is inherently more dangerous; it often reflects the nature of the community itself. For instance, a high volume of noise complaints in a dense residential area is to be expected and does not indicate a failing neighborhood. Another common myth is that public data can be used to profile individuals or areas in a discriminatory manner. Responsible analysis focuses on systemic patterns and environmental factors, never on stigmatizing specific groups or individuals. By correcting these misinterpretations, we can foster a more intelligent and compassionate dialogue about community safety.
